PENGARANG : IMAM MUDITA

Abstract
It is possible to achieve three-dimensional GPS positioning accuracies of a few centimetres on board a hydrographic survey vessel, on a ship navigating through a difficult passage, or even on a water-level sensing buoy. The name given to this mode of using GPS is “on-the-fly differential GPS carrier phase integer cycle ambiguity resolution”. In this paper we refer to this simply as OTF (for “On-The-Fly”) GPS. OTF GPS has the potential for aiding precise sea level measurement efforts by providing the ability to regionally densify altimetric measurements, or measuring the wave displacement which still relies on the double integration of the vertical acceleration or even possibly to linking of traditional tide gauges to a well-established geocentric terrestrial reference frame. This paper presents current progress of the project “Buoy GPS for Sea Level Measurement” conducted in the Baruna Jaya Technical Services Unit – BPP Teknologi in partnership with Geodesy Laboratory-ITB and BAKOSURTANAL, National Agency for Coordinating Survey and Mapping awarded by the Ministry of Research and Technology, under the 9th Intregrated Competitive Research Programme. The objectives of the project are to address the problem of observing sea level from a GPS equipped buoy.

PENGARANG : M.Ilyas ,Handoko Manoto, Bayu Sutedjo,Heri Purwanto ,

Abstract
Baruna Jaya Technical Services Unit has submerged artificial reefs in Kelapa Island, regency of Seribu Islands. One and five years after deployment we monitored and evaluated of it’s the results. With used underwater camera and diving methods have recorded the results of growing and the existing of the reef and other organisms in the location of artificial reefs. We found preliminary result that artificial reef as artificial habitat may able to stimulate growing of the coral and constitute habitat for fish and other aquatic organisms. Coralline algae, sponges, juvenile of reef fish, and other organisms have been found in and around of material artificial reefs.

PENGARANG : Harianto

Abstract
Transport of live fish to markets, sometimes several hundred kilometers away, has risks of mortality of fish. A prototipe of land transporatation equipment has been made that contain of three hauling tank, pump circulation, filter, water chiller, air blower, oxygen tube, completed with air and water distribution pipe. The unit was attached to flatbed of truck. A performancy test of the prototipe was conducted for hauling adult tiger grouper fish (Epinephelus fuscoguttatus). The test was performed in two steps. First, it was static testing twelve hours along for three fish density level per tank; 120, 260, and 240. Second, trip testing, that was performed around city during twelve hours and inter city trip from Jepara (Middle Jawa) to Serpong (West Jawa). Result of the test indicated that the capacity can reached 400 fishes for each tank. During the test for 12 hours transportation it was no mortality of fishes, and for 26 hours transportation the survival rate was 99%. Ratio of fish with water was 1 : 5,5.

PENGARANG : Andi Jamaluddin, Irfan Eko Sandjaja

Abstract
The usual definition on an Airboat is a water transportation vehicle using the air as a medium for propulsion, rather than the water itself. The most common method for the airboat to achieve forward motion is through use of a propeller. The thrust propels the boat forward; steering is accomplished by means of a rudder or rudders positioned in the thrust air stream. The airboat is generally constructed by aluminum or fiberglass with a polymer/flat bottom. It can be operated in areas in accessible to other boats. The ideal environment for the airboat is shallow water such as marshes and swamps. However, it also performs very well in deep water covered with vegetation or trash that would block other types of boats. Therefore the airboat can be design for general transportation, recreations, hobby or sports, seismic research, short distances across land security and SAR purposes.

PENGARANG : Harianto
Pusat Pengkajian dan Penerapan Teknologi Agroindustri
Deputi Bidang T A B, BPPT
Abstract

Grouper as one of Indonesian export comodity has high economic value, especially when it is traded lively. Live fish from Indonesia is transported to Hongkong market by air freighting or shipping. Unfortunately transporting live grouper has high risk of fish mortality. Solving this problem, it has resulted the technology of land transport equipment and technique of packaging for air freightening transportation of live grouper. The purpose of this paper is to discuss wether the investment of application of those technology for export business is feasible or not in the view of finansial aspects. The project investment is Rp 941.093.400 included working capital. The operation capacity is 48.000 kg live tiger grouper (Epinephelus fuscoguttatus) per year. Based on the financial analysis, it can be concluded that the project looks feasible. This can be indicated by Net Present Value (Rp 197.840.442), Internal Rate of Return (30,1%), Net Benefit Cost Ratio (1,21) and Pay Back Period (2 years and 8 months). From the sensivity analysis shows the project is ever feasible although the rupiah is depressiated or apressiated 10% to US dollar. The project sensitizes from the changes of production cost.

PENGARANG : Yudhi Soetrisno GARNO
Abstract

This paper report a research to decided a phytoplankton counting method which could present representative data of phytoplankton community in Harapan island. The research suggested that data of settling methode was more representative than data of thick methode due to underestimation occurred during theicken process using centrifuse. It was suggested that during the period of research the coastal water of Harapan insland was an olygotrophic with phythoplankton density about 654,7-1.745 ind · ml -1 . The phytoplankton community was dominated by Chaetoceros.
